Are frilled neck lizards only found in the Australian desert?

Frilled-neck lizards are not desert lizards. They live in tropical woodlands in northern Australia and parts of New Guinea.

Predator of a frilled neck lizard?

The main predators of frilled neck lizards are birds of prey, snakes, and larger lizards. These predators are able to catch the frilled neck lizard either on the ground or in the trees where they live. The frilled neck lizard has developed its unique defensive display of extending its frill to try to scare off potential predators.
